Hi there!
I have a partridge silkie hen that is a little over a year old. She is in with two roosters and another hen. The hen is walking upright, kind of like a penguin and her rear is very bloated. She had some stool stuck in the feathers below the vent so I cleaned her off. She also felt warm, but it has been very hot in Ohio lately. I put some cool/cold water on her legs and she cooled off a lot. Her rear is not discolored or reddened but is obvious. I gently pulled her vent down and pushed softly on the bulge and very stinky green poop came out. The bulge is also soft, not hard.

Would it be good to get all of the poop out of her? To keep massaging and get it all out? Or could there be a bigger problem?
